Planning and Review Committee
The PRC is a standing committee of the Faculty Senate that conducts regular program reviews:
First review is five years after new program approval; subsequently, every seven years
Documentation includes: Program self study Surveys of key instructors, advisory board, program alumni Reports strengths, areas for improvement, and recommendations

Curriculum & Instruction CommitteeObjectives of the CIC:
• Review, develop and recommend new and/or modified curriculum policies
• Serve as an academic forum to discuss and act upon proposals for credit-producing learning experiences as well as academic programs
• Encourage a transdisciplinary approach to curriculum and instructional growth
• Promote academic excellence and educational opportunity and encourage the use of appropriate standards throughout the curriculum
